Benign Prostatic Hyperplasia Causes and Overview
Benign prostatic hyperplasia (BPH), commonly referred to as prostate enlargement, is a condition that affects many aging men. While the exact cause of BPH has not been fully identified, two key contributing factors are aging and the presence of functional testicles. These two elements are essential for the development of the condition.
Age plays a significant role in the development of prostate enlargement. As men grow older, particularly beyond the age of 45, the likelihood of prostate growth increases. Most men begin to experience noticeable symptoms after the age of 50, which can include difficulty urinating, frequent urination, or a weak urine stream.
Another critical factor is hormonal imbalance. Changes in estrogen levels, along with shifts in testosterone and dihydrotestosterone (DHT), can contribute to prostate growth. As men age, the balance of these hormones changes, which can stimulate the proliferation of prostate cells. This hormonal shift, combined with the influence of various growth factors and interstitial cell activity, plays a major role in the progression of BPH.
In addition to biological factors, lifestyle and environmental influences have also been linked to prostate enlargement. Recent studies suggest that smoking, obesity, excessive alcohol consumption, family history, race, and geographic location can all impact the likelihood of developing BPH. Men with a family history of prostate issues or those belonging to certain ethnic groups may be at higher risk.
In conclusion, nearly every aging man may experience some degree of prostate enlargement. If symptoms become bothersome, medical treatment may be necessary. Several treatment options are currently available, with the most widely accepted and prescribed being alpha-blockers such as tamsulosin hydrochloride, and 5-alpha-reductase inhibitors like finasteride, which are proven to help manage the condition effectively.
